


About This Property
Discover what makes this home specialThe Blacksmith is a charming detached two-bedroom home located in a peaceful residential development in Macclesfield, Cheshire. This property offers a well-designed layout with a spacious living/dining room that opens onto the rear garden, a separate kitchen, and a convenient cloakroom on the ground floor. Upstairs, you will find two good-sized bedrooms with built-in wardrobes and a family bathroom. The property benefits from ample storage space and a private garden that enjoys a favorable south-east aspect, providing pleasant natural light throughout the day.
Situated in the SK10 3LH postcode, this home is ideal for those seeking a quiet suburban lifestyle while still being within easy reach of Macclesfield town centre and Manchester city. The location offers good transport links, local schools, and a range of amenities, making it suitable for first-time buyers, downsizers, or investors looking for a solid rental opportunity.
